WebThose are bit fields. Basically, the number after the colon describes how many bits that field uses. Here is a quote from MSDN describing bit fields: The constant-expression specifies the width of the field in bits. The type-specifier for the declarator must be unsigned int, signed int, or int, and the constant-expression must be a nonnegative ... WebThere are two bit shift operators in C++: the left shift operator &lt;&lt; and the right shift operator &gt;&gt;. These operators cause the bits in the left operand to be shifted left or right by the number of positions specified by the right operand. In C++, bitwise operators perform operations on integer data at the individual bit-level. These operations include testing, setting, or shifting the actual bits.
